Has a WNBA game ever ended 61-59?
Yes. WNBA has seen a final score of 61-59 11 times. It first happened on July 27, 1999, when Minnesota Lynx beat Sacramento Monarchs, and most recently on July 31, 2019, when Indiana Fever beat Atlanta Dream.
